excel公式正确但不显示结果怎么回事儿呢
作者:excel百科网
|
388人看过
发布时间:2026-03-05 15:48:42
当您在Excel(电子表格)中遇到公式正确但不显示结果的问题时,通常是因为单元格格式被错误地设置为“文本”、计算选项被设为“手动”,或开启了“显示公式”模式,只需逐一检查并修正这些设置即可恢复正常。
excel公式正确但不显示结果怎么回事儿呢,这恐怕是许多Excel(电子表格)使用者,从新手到资深用户都可能碰上的一个经典难题。您明明输入了一个看起来毫无瑕疵的公式,比如“=A1+B1”,或者一个复杂的函数组合,敲下回车键后,单元格里显示的却不是预期的计算结果,而是公式本身,或者干脆是一个静态的数字0、一个错误值,甚至是一片空白。这种情形不仅令人困惑,更会严重影响工作效率。别着急,这并非您的公式逻辑出了问题,绝大多数情况下,根源在于Excel(电子表格)软件本身的一些设置或单元格的特定状态被无意中更改了。接下来,我们将深入探讨十几个最常见的原因及其对应的解决方案,帮助您彻底扫清障碍。
首要排查点:单元格格式是否为“文本”这是导致公式不显示结果最常见的原因,没有之一。Excel(电子表格)有一个基本规则:如果某个单元格的格式被预先设置成了“文本”,那么您在其中输入的任何内容,包括以等号“=”开头的公式,都会被软件当作普通的文字字符来处理,而不是可执行的指令。因此,它会原封不动地显示您输入的“=A1+B1”这串字符。解决方法是:选中该单元格,在“开始”选项卡的“数字”格式组中,将格式从“文本”更改为“常规”或您需要的其他数字格式(如“数值”、“会计专用”等),然后双击单元格进入编辑状态,直接按回车键确认即可。有时,您可能需要按F2键进入编辑模式再回车。 检查全局计算选项:是否误设为“手动”Excel(电子表格)默认的计算模式是“自动”,这意味着当您更改公式所引用的单元格数据时,所有相关公式的结果都会立即自动更新。但是,如果计算选项被无意中切换到了“手动”,那么您输入新公式或修改数据后,公式结果就不会自动计算和显示,工作表会保持“静止”状态。您可以在“公式”选项卡下,找到“计算选项”,确保其设置为“自动”。如果您的工作簿计算模式是“手动”,您可以通过按键盘上的F9键来强制进行一次全局计算。 “显示公式”模式是否被意外开启这是一个非常直观的原因。在“公式”选项卡下,有一个“显示公式”的按钮(或者使用快捷键Ctrl+`,即反引号键)。当这个功能被激活时,工作表中所有包含公式的单元格将不再显示计算结果,而是直接显示公式的文本内容。这常用于检查公式结构或进行错误排查。如果您发现整个工作表都在显示公式代码,只需再次点击“显示公式”按钮或按Ctrl+`关闭该模式即可。 审视公式是否被前置空格或撇号干扰有时,在公式的等号“=”前面,可能不小心输入了一个空格,或者一个英文的单引号“’”。单引号在Excel(电子表格)中是一个特殊符号,它用于强制将后续内容标识为文本。如果单元格内容以单引号开头,即使格式是“常规”,整个内容也会被当作文本处理。请双击单元格进入编辑状态,仔细检查公式最前方是否有不可见的空格或单引号,并将其删除。 单元格内容是否因“剪切”操作而异常这是一个不太常见但确实存在的陷阱。如果您不是通过“复制-粘贴”,而是使用“剪切”(Ctrl+X)操作移动了一个包含公式的单元格,有时公式会失去其计算属性,变成一个静态值或文本。更稳妥的做法是使用“复制”(Ctrl+C)和“粘贴”(Ctrl+V),或者在移动时使用鼠标拖拽功能。 检查是否存在循环引用循环引用是指一个公式直接或间接地引用了自身所在的单元格。例如,在A1单元格中输入“=A1+1”。当Excel(电子表格)检测到循环引用时,它可能无法计算出结果,并会在状态栏显示“循环引用”的警告。您需要检查并修正公式的逻辑,打破这种自我引用。 公式所引用的单元格本身是否为文本格式即使您的公式单元格格式正确,但如果公式计算所引用的源单元格(例如A1或B1)被设置成了“文本”格式,那么即便其中看起来是数字,Excel(电子表格)在进行数学运算时也可能将其视为0或产生错误。确保所有参与计算的源数据单元格格式也为“常规”或“数值”。 数字是否被存储为“文本”形式有时,从外部系统(如网页、数据库或其他软件)导入的数据,数字左侧可能带有绿色的小三角标记,这表示该数字是以“文本”形式存储的。这种“文本型数字”无法直接参与运算。您可以选中这些单元格,旁边会出现一个感叹号提示框,点击并选择“转换为数字”即可。 工作表或工作簿是否被设置为“保护”状态如果工作表或特定单元格区域被设置了保护,并且权限中禁止了编辑公式或计算,那么公式也可能无法正常显示或更新结果。您需要联系工作簿的创建者或拥有密码的管理员,撤销保护或获取编辑权限。 使用“错误检查”功能辅助诊断Excel(电子表格)内置了强大的错误检查工具。当单元格出现潜在问题时,其左上角可能会显示一个绿色的小三角。选中该单元格,旁边会浮现一个带有感叹号的图标,点击它可以查看错误提示,例如“数字以文本形式存储”、“公式引用空单元格”等,并根据建议进行修复。 检查Excel(电子表格)选项中的高级设置进入“文件”->“选项”->“高级”菜单,向下滚动到“此工作表的显示选项”区域。请确保“在单元格中显示公式而非其计算结果”这个复选框没有被勾选。同时,也检查一下“允许自动百分比输入”等选项,虽然不常见,但某些高级设置可能会间接影响计算行为。 公式结果是否因列宽不足而被隐藏如果公式计算出的结果是一个较长的数字或一段文本,而所在列的宽度太窄,单元格可能显示为“”或显示不完整。这并非公式未计算,而是显示问题。您只需调整列宽,将鼠标移至列标题的右侧边界,双击即可自动调整为合适宽度。 考虑加载项或宏的潜在冲突如果您的工作簿中使用了第三方加载项或复杂的VBA(Visual Basic for Applications)宏代码,极少数情况下,这些外部程序可能会干扰Excel(电子表格)的正常计算引擎。您可以尝试在安全模式下启动Excel(电子表格)(按住Ctrl键的同时点击启动),或者暂时禁用所有加载项,看看问题是否消失。 文件本身是否损坏在极其罕见的情况下,工作簿文件本身可能损坏,导致计算功能异常。您可以尝试将有问题的工作表内容复制到一个全新的工作簿文件中,看看公式是否能恢复正常计算。这通常能有效隔离文件损坏导致的问题。 更新或修复您的Excel(电子表格)应用程序如果以上所有方法都无效,且问题出现在多个工作簿中,那么可能是您使用的Excel(电子表格)软件本身存在临时故障或漏洞。尝试彻底关闭所有Excel(电子表格)窗口并重新打开。如果问题持续,可以考虑运行Office(办公软件)的修复功能,或者将软件更新到最新版本。 通过以上这十几个方面的系统排查,相信您一定能定位并解决“excel公式正确但不显示结果怎么回事儿呢”这个恼人的问题。总结来说,解决问题的路径通常是从最简单的设置检查开始——单元格格式、计算选项、显示公式模式,这是解决大部分情况的“三板斧”。如果无效,再逐步深入到引用数据、保护状态、文件完整性等更深层次的原因。养成规范的数据输入习惯,并了解这些常见的设置陷阱,将能极大提升您使用Excel(电子表格)的流畅度和信心。记住,当公式沉默时,往往是软件在用它自己的方式提醒您,某些背后的规则需要被关注和调整。
推荐文章
当Excel公式部分出错时,我们可以通过使用IFERROR、IFNA等函数,或者结合逻辑判断函数,让公式在遇到错误时能自动忽略错误值,继续执行并保留正确的计算结果,从而确保数据表格的整洁与后续分析的顺利进行。
2026-03-05 15:47:32
64人看过
将Excel公式转为数值公式,用户通常希望将动态计算结果固定为静态数值,以防止数据因引用变动而改变,并提升文件处理效率。这可通过复制粘贴为值、使用选择性粘贴、借助快捷键或编写简单宏来实现,确保数据稳定性和分享安全性。
2026-03-05 15:46:47
134人看过
当您遇到excel公式乱码不显示的问题时,核心解决思路在于系统性地排查并修正单元格格式、字体兼容性、公式语法、系统区域设置以及文件本身可能存在的编码或损坏问题。excel公式乱码不显示通常不是单一原因造成,需要从显示、计算、环境等多个层面入手,才能彻底恢复公式的正常运算与结果呈现。
2026-03-05 15:45:49
327人看过
将Excel公式转换为值,核心是通过复制粘贴为数值、使用选择性粘贴功能或借助快捷键等方式,将包含公式的单元格内容固定为计算结果,从而防止公式因引用数据变化而更新,确保数据的稳定性和可移植性。掌握这一技能能显著提升数据处理效率,是日常办公中的必备技巧。
2026-03-05 15:45:41
107人看过

.webp)
.webp)
.webp)